Background: Elizabeth Warren’s Life and Career
Before we dive into the details of her home, let’s take a moment to appreciate Elizabeth Warren’s remarkable journey. Born in Oklahoma City in 1949, Warren grew up in a working-class family. Her passion for education led her to earn a degree in speech pathology and audiology from the University of Houston, followed by a law degree from Rutgers Law School.
Warren’s career has been nothing short of impressive. From her early days as a Harvard Law School professor to her current role as a U.S. Senator from Massachusetts, she has consistently championed causes like financial regulation, consumer protection, and education. Her 2020 presidential campaign further solidified her position as a leading voice in American politics.

Where Dose Elizabeth Warre Currently Live?
Elizabeth Warren currently lives in Cambridge, Massachusetts. She and her husband, Bruce Mann, have lived there for decades in a spacious 1890 Victorian home in the Avon Hill neighborhood. The home has significantly increased in value since they purchased it in 1995. Despite her national political profile, she remains a familiar face in Cambridge and lives there with their golden retriever, Bailey.
